    Hello, I am also a cyclic vomiting patient, so I have done a lot of research recently. Periodic vomiting usually occurs in small children, and the condition goes away on its own when the child is older or about 13 years old. So you don't have to be too nervous now.

    A large part of the reasons that happen are mental. Depression, anxiety, nervousness, and even your sister being bullied and criticized at school can all cause this vomiting. It is recommended that you communicate with the school teacher to see how she is in a good mental state.

    The most annoying thing about this condition is that excessive vomiting leads to dehydration, low potassium, and rising white blood cells – but this rise in white blood cells is not caused by inflammation, but by mental stress. Antibiotics are not recommended.

    Eating smaller, more frequent meals can relieve this symptom. Another point is to find the fuse and the trigger. Chocolate, coffee, alcohol can all cause stomach upset.

    My personal experience is to take antiemetics as soon as you feel like vomiting and go to sleep to avoid vomiting. Because you also know that once it happens, vomiting can't stop. After taking the medicine and sleeping, it may be fine to wake up.

    It is recommended that you take your cousin to do an electroencephalogram and CT first to rule out organic lesions, whether it is epilepsy or something in the brain that compresses the nerves.

    If your cousin has some events when she has a "cramp" attack, or if she is always in a presence of people when she has an attack, and if she will avoid dangerous places, you should consider whether it is hysteria, which belongs to the category of psychology, and you can take her to the psychology department to see a psychological counselor.

    You can't immediately decide which one it is! It may be epilepsy

    It is a symptom of abnormal discharge caused by abnormal excitation of cells in the central brain system, resulting in seizures in the body and organs.

    Shape. Epilepsy is a chronic brain lesion caused by congenital or acquired causes, and it can affect any brain.

    The performance of the function is not just causing convulsions and unconsciousness.

    Absence seizure

    Also known as petit mal, it is a transient seizure that occurs in children between the ages of 6 and 14.

    Make. During the seizure, the patient presents with confusion and temporary interruption of movement, sometimes with a straightened or straight eye.

    Constant eye-lowering and chewing movements. The absence seizure is short-lived, and it ends in a few seconds, and the original pause is again.

    Continuously, the patient is confused about the merger, and others often mistake the patient for being in a daze.

    Grand mal

    The seizures are very violent, usually accompanied by a sudden loss of consciousness and stiffness or plonging of the limbs.
